@Iron Keys thanks man, I thouroughly appreciate that.

So! I went with a little bit of a different approach towards constructing the drums this time around. They are programmed on this one. I have a decent amount of drumkits that Ive come across over the years; Im actually more than happy to share. However, what I did was start with the basic kick and snare, played those out etc. I was trying to play a hat along with those, but was failing miserably because I just havent practiced finger drumming to that extent (just using mpk for that at times). I sat for a bit and was really thinking of how to get in the pocket period... the key for me in this flip was finding it for the hats rather than the snare. With that, sent kicks to their own bus, light compression. From there, sent snares and kick bus to a rough drum mix - ran the LA2A and stock fruity reverb 2 in that order.

Just realized - depending on the flow/vibe, I typically layer my kicks and snares just for a little extra beef. Though some people may disagree, theres ways to go about it subtley.
